
Comme des Garcons has long been considered one of the premier labels in Japanese fashion, as it has been one of the few Japanese domestic labels to achieve worldwide recognition in the fashion industry at large. Rei Kawakubo’s company expanded from simple roots to acclaim around the world, and a staple in the fashion world. The Japanese domestic fashion market in general has always been a little different from the world at large, sometimes for the better, other times for the worse. Nevertheless, Japan has always been a mover and shaker in the fashion world, especially in streetwear, and this latest release from Comme des Garcons is definitely something interesting. Featuring Osomatsu-kun, a popular Japanese manga character from the 1960s, these shoes may not have much appeal for those outside Japan, but for the Japanese, this is definitely a real nostalgia piece. Even for those that haven’t watched the anime, or read the manga, these shoes are definitely something different and exciting, and are now available at Colette’s eshop in both low and high top versions. Although a skate brand, Supra sneakers aren’t usually the shoes of choice for the typical skater, more seen on the feet of fashion and style enthusiasts. The company has always been known for their flashy designs and colors, as seen on this yellow Supra Vaider. The sneaker is bound to turn a few heads with its stylish combination of shiny patent leather and regular, perforated leather. Not to take away from the technology of the shoe, a cushioning SupraFoam midsole is featured along with a durable vulcanized sole. Also, the high cut ankle provides for great support, potentially preventing injury. There is no word yet on when these sneakers will be releasing. via Sneaker Freaker

Saucony, a brand that has definitely been a bit under the radar lately, has just released this great pair of Courageous TR’s. While not the most traditional looking of their models, these Courageous TR’s are definitely some of the most visually powerful in the Saucony lineup of kicks. With a primarily grey upper, the green accenting is what really gives these kicks some visual pop. While the design of the Courageous may not be quite for everyone’s tastes, the lines of this shoe will undoubtedly find some admirers amongst the sneakerhead population. These kicks are definitely a sign of Saucony’s rise in the urban fashion realm, and a clear image of their current design philosophy. Look for these now at select Foot Lockers.

Recently we caught a few photos of Paul Rodriguez doing every skaters favorite task, setting up a new complete. However Paul was accomplishing this feat in ultimate style wearing what seems to be a test wear version of his newest Signature shoe. The shoes seem to have very similar theory to the P-Rod 2. The most apparent changes are a new lacing system and a less padded tongue. Sneaker Freaker recently held an interview with Paul Rodriguez where he mentioned the shoes are slated for a Summer 2009 release, however we may still see some changes to the model before they hit the streets. Es has just dropped their latest color way for Pro Rider Justin Eldridge’s signature skate shoe. The shoes are dubbed the ‘Theory’ Mids and have released in a variety of colors. This time around the shoes feature a premium navy and brown leather upper. The shoes come in a mid for extra ankle support and feature a velcro strap across the bottom laces for stability and lace protection. The shoes also feature a skater friendly vulcanized sole for extra grip and flexibility. A System G2™ heel cushioning gel insert adds extra comfort whether your cruising the streets or trying to bust a hard flip down that 16 stair. Available now at In4mation

It has long been rumored that Nike SB has planned their second signature shoe for team rider Stefan Janoski. Here we are lucky enough to catch a sneak peak of the upcoming sneakers. The sneakers appear to be very skater friendly featuring a low cut suede upper and a vulcanized sole. The shoes seem to take many influences from a Vans Chukka Lows, Nike SB Zoom Harbors, or perhaps even a Nike Air Sabuku. Originally rumored to be releasing in October. Stay tuned for more info.

Originally made for a special release during a Stash art show at Colette in 2002, Reconstore.com has suprisingly made the Stash designed Gravis Pack available on their web store as an exclusive. The pack features a pair of Gravis Lokash Shoes and a matching laptop bag with a custom camo print. The premium soft leather of the Lokash is embellished with a perforated with the ‘Subware’ logo. While the shoes have the streets at heart, they are fairly dressy as well.
